- Quarterly review of logical access of PRO vendors
- Research publically disclosed security threats in the wider retail environment
- Assist in ongoing security process awareness between Portfolio and Product teams
- Assisting in maintaining an up-to-date inventory for all licensees and vendors
- Measuring and tracking the assessment of all vendors within the SDS
- Support the ongoing effective engagement of technology security Team and technology operations
- Supporting and monitoring the security intake process and the reporting the estimated LOE required
- Shadowing technology security team members in key meetings ensuring actions are owned
- Supporting technology security manager in BAU activities
What training will the apprentice take and what qualification will the apprentice get at the end?
- Estio/BPP apprenticeship training programmes are delivered virtually by our fully qualified and industry experienced training team. Using their expert knowledge, we've purposefully built our programmes around the real-world use of modern technology, so that the skills we create can be directly applied in the workplace
- Throughout the apprenticeship learners receive coaching, help and guidance from a dedicated team who are there to ensure they get the most from their work experience
- Successful completion of this apprenticeship gives you an accredited Level 6 Digital and Technology Solutions Professional Degree Apprenticeship
